Water is very important element in civilization. Social life developed on the bank of Water-source. The mental as well as social health plays vital role for remarkable growth of society. For that purpose, Pure, potable and palatable water to be supplied to the society and to maintain the hygiene of it, the waste water must be collected and treated properly before disposed of in nature, so the natural flora and fauna will not get affected by sewage disposal. In present time, solid waste also wants more attention. The technician must know about the quality as well as quantity of domestic water to be supplied to the society. Similarly, technician should be conversant with the collection, conveyance, treatment and disposal of waste water.
